Output 98ec66823a18e57c512326d285f12e28c303790d4d3a535ac1a7ee999d9ce7de:20

value
1383747
script pubkey
OP_0 OP_PUSHBYTES_20 202508fd076b8629b42163d511a23559f4cdca1e
address
bc1qyqjs3lg8dwrzndppv023rg34t86vmjs7wfpwnr
transaction
98ec66823a18e57c512326d285f12e28c303790d4d3a535ac1a7ee999d9ce7de
confirmations
135468
spent
true